The read// why locals go
A small candlelit room on Westminster Avenue in Wolseley, cooking comfort food that happens to suit almost everyone at the table. Bonnie Day opened in 2021 in the space Winnipeggers knew as the Ruby West, with chef Pamela Kirkpatrick running a kitchen that works two shifts: a café through the daytime, a proper resto in the evening. The plates people come back for are the whipped feta, hand-rolled sweet potato gnocchi in lemon cream, the pizzas and the vegan galette, with a natural wine list kept short and personal. The name nods to the owners' Scottish heritage and, said aloud, to the French for good idea. The room is small — book ahead.
